In the ongoing second Test match, England finds itself in a precarious position as they chase an imposing target of 608 runs set by India. Currently, the English team has lost three wickets, raising concerns about their ability to sustain the pressure and mount a competitive challenge. The match scenario underscores the impressive performance of the Indian bowling attack, which has managed to unsettle the English batsmen, leading to early dismissals. As the game progresses, every wicket becomes crucial, and England will need to dig deep to navigate the challenging conditions and the formidable target.
However, amidst the excitement of the match, there is a significant concern for the Indian side. While their bowling unit is performing well, the team’s fielding has come under scrutiny. There have been instances of missed opportunities, with dropped catches and misfields that could prove costly in a high-stakes encounter like this. The ability to capitalize on every chance is vital, especially when defending a large total. If India fails to tighten their fielding, it could provide England with the lifeline they need to stabilize their innings and build a partnership that could alter the course of the match.
